舵机控制算法
舵机控制算法
舵机控制,听起来是不是很高深?其实,它就像是舵机的“大脑”,指挥着舵机按照我们的指令精确地转动。对于很多工程师来说,选择合适的舵机控制,就像是在为机器人挑选最合适的“舞步编排师”。今天,我们就来聊聊这个舵机控制的世界,看看它是如何让舵机变得灵动自如的。
舵机控制是什么?
舵机控制,简单来说,就是用来控制舵机转动的一套规则。它决定了舵机如何响应我们的指令,如何调整角度,以及如何保持稳定。就像是一个聪明的舞者,舵机控制让舵机在各种复杂的动作中依然保持优雅和精准。
为什么舵机控制很重要?
舵机控制的重要性不言而喻。它直接影响着舵机的响应速度、精度和稳定性。想象一下,如果你在控制一个复杂的机器人,舵机控制就像是机器人的神经系统,负责传递指令和反馈信息。如果这个神经系统不够高效或者不够精准,机器人可能会动作迟缓,甚至失去平衡。
常见的舵机控制有哪些?
在舵机控制领域,主要有以下几种常见的控制:
比例积分微分(PID)控制:这是最常见的舵机控制之一。PID控制通过不断调整舵机的角度,使得实际角度与目标角度之间的误差最小化。它就像是一个勤奋的老师,不断纠正舵机的偏差,直到它达到最佳状态。
模糊控制:模糊控制是一种基于模糊逻辑的控制方法。它通过模拟人类的模糊思维,使得舵机在面对不确定性和复杂性时,依然能够保持稳定和灵活。这种方法在处理非线性系统和不确定性时表现尤为出色。
预测控制(MPC):预测控制是一种基于系统的控制方法。它通过预测系统的未来状态,当前的控制输入,从而实现更精确的控制。这种方法在需要高精度和复杂控制的场景中非常有用。
如何选择适合的舵机控制?
选择适合的舵机控制,需要考虑以下几个因素:
系统的复杂性:如果你的系统比较简单,PID控制可能就足够了。但如果你的系统复杂,涉及多个变量和非线性关系,可能需要考虑模糊控制或预测控制。
控制精度:如果你需要极高的控制精度,预测控制可能是更好的选择。而如果你只需要中等精度,PID控制可能就足够了。
系统的响应速度:如果你需要舵机快速响应,模糊控制可能更适合,因为它能够在不确定性和复杂性中快速调整。
舵机控制的参数设置
在设置舵机控制的参数时,需要注意以下几点:
比例系数(Kp):比例系数决定了舵机对当前误差的反应速度。如果比例系数太大,舵机会过于敏感,可能会导致振荡;如果太小,舵机可能会反应迟钝。
积分系数(Ki):积分系数决定了舵机对累积误差的反应。如果积分系数太大,可能会导致舵机过冲;如果太小,可能会导致舵机无法完全消除误差。
微分系数(Kd):微分系数决定了舵机对误差变化的反应。如果微分系数太大,可能会导致舵机过于敏感;如果太小,可能会导致舵机无法快速响应。
舵机控制的实际应用
舵机控制在实际应用中非常广泛。无论是工业自动化、智能机器人,还是无人机,舵机控制都是不可或缺的一部分。例如,在工业自动化中,舵机控制可以帮助机器人精确地完成各种复杂的动作;在智能机器人中,舵机控制可以让机器人更加灵活和智能;在无人机中,舵机控制可以帮助无人机保持稳定和平衡。
舵机控制是舵机的灵魂,它决定了舵机如何响应我们的指令,如何调整角度,以及如何保持稳定。选择合适的舵机控制,就像是为舵机挑选了一位聪明的“舞步编排师”。无论是PID控制、模糊控制,还是预测控制,每种都有其独特的优势和适用场景。通过合理选择和设置参数,我们可以让舵机在各种复杂环境中依然保持精准和稳定。
伟创动力Kpower成立于2005年,至今20多年历史,国内最早的舵机生产厂家,年产700万件。伟创动力Kpower公司场地规模47000平米,拥有员工300多人,年产值超3亿元。伟创动力Kpower公司有用超过150项专利技术,获得了IATF16949 汽车质量体系认证,ISO14001产品质量体系认证,ISO9001产品质量体系认证,产品CE认证,产品FCC认证,同时伟创动力Kpower还获得了红点设计奖,得到了行业的非常多的奖项和认可。同时,伟创动力获得了行业的高度认可,合作服务的客户包含了世界500强企业华为,大疆无人机,雅迪电动车,美团无人机,追觅扫地机器人,方太洗地机器人,红旗汽车,比亚迪汽车,小鹏,小米,索尼,大族激光等超过500家大型企业,包含了各个行业的龙头领军企业,还有像航天集团这样的军工企业。而且,伟创动力的标准化产品远销全球,包含了美国,德国,巴西,意大利,韩国等诸多国家。